=46rom the readme: /usr/share/doc/fontconfig-2.2.96/README
This is the third public release of fontconfig, a font configuration and
customization library. Fontconfig is designed to locate fonts within the
system and select them according to requirements specified by applications.
Fontconfig is not a rasterization library, nor does it impose a particular
rasterization library on the application. The X-specific library
'Xft' uses fontconfig along with freetype to specify and rasterize fonts.
Keith Packard
keithp@keithp.com
More info is at http://www.fontconfig.org/wiki/. This is the way most Linux
distros are now managing fonts.
> >2) Is there a WinList font setting separate from the Window title settin=
g?=20
> >I'd like to crank down the WinList fonts, but keep Window titles bigger.
> MyStyles to use could be defined by these WinList options :
>=20
> *WinListFocusedStyle "style"
> *WinListUnfocusedStyle "style"
> *WinListStickyStyle "style"
>=20
> If any of these is not defined then WinList will try to use :
>=20
> "focused_window_style"
> "unfocused_window_style"
> "sticky_window_style"
>=20
> Then if any of the styles remain undefined, then WinList will use :
>=20
> "*WinList"
>=20
> And finally default MyStyle will be used for anything that still remains=
=20
> undefined.
